A screen shot from The Seattle Times says:
Steves was in Phoenix on Nov. 10 when he checked a hometown news blog and felt his eye catch on a story about the center's impending closure. He recognized the building, where he remembered taking his car to get its emissions checked.
Steves, who didn't know what a hygiene center was before last month, called his purchase "the most beautiful Christmas present (he) could have."
Unfortunately, @seattletimes.com erased the non-profit @myedmondsnews.bsky.social and the reporting by @a-rlnt.bsky.social that made this story possible.

Thanks to Rick Steves, Lynnwood Hygiene Center has a permanent home | MLTnews.com
‘If this place wasn’t here I don’t know how I would’ve survived’ -- Sherman Gillins The Jean Kim Foundation’s (JKF) Hygiene Center in Lynnwood is here to
Our coverage of the closing of a local hygiene center last month spurred a philanthropist to buy the property for $2M. Donors in WA & other states chipped in remaining $500K to secure the land.
